Cheap and expensive hookahs: what's the difference?
A hookah is a consumer product akin to clothing or electronic devices. A high price tag does not necessarily equate to superior quality, just as a lower price does not inherently imply inferiority. It is essential to examine the components that contribute to the pricing of hookahs and to identify key factors to consider when making a selection.
Distinguishing between inexpensive and premium hookahs: what are the key differences?
Factors influencing pricing
Material of the shaft
Most of good models are typically made from stainless steel, whereas lower-quality options may be constructed from inexpensive metal alloys. Such materials tend to deteriorate in appearance after only a few uses due to their inability to withstand prolonged exposure to water.
Investing a bit more in a hookah with a stainless steel shaft is advisable, as it will offer greater durability and eliminate the need for future replacements. Additionally, consider other materials such as brass or copper.
Material of the hose
A leather hose featuring an internal spring is reminiscent of designs from the early 2000s. Leather tends to absorb odors, and frequent attempts to clean it can lead to rusting of the internal spring, resulting in a diminished taste experience.
Opt for a silicone hose with a Soft Touch finish. This material is highly resistant to moisture and can be cleaned thoroughly without concern.
Height of the hookah
Inexpensive models generally measure between 25-30 cm in height. Such short designs do not allow the smoke sufficient time to cool, leading to an unpleasant experience for smokers.
An ideal height for a hookah should range from 40-60 cm. This measurement is a significant factor in determining the price, as larger models require more material.
Quality of the bowl
In the lower price range, hookah bowls tend to be very basic in terms of material. Ceramic materials are often used, which do not distribute heat effectively, which causes the tobacco to burn faster. It is advisable to choose higher quality clay bowls.
Smoking comfort
Seasoned hookah enthusiasts can easily differentiate between a low-cost and a high-quality hookah. If the hose and shaft are excessively narrow, they may require considerable effort to draw smoke. The inner diameter of the shaft should ideally be around 12-13 mm, then the smoke will pass more freely.
